*What does a Dental Hygienist do?*As a Dental Hygienist at Toothio, your responsibilities include conducting initial patient screenings, performing teeth cleaning (such as plaque removal), and providing guidance on oral health and preventative care. Collaborate with dentists to determine treatments for teeth or gum diseases.
We're looking for reliable individuals capable of building trust with patients of all ages, possessing deep knowledge of health and safety rules and a keen eye for oral diseases and anomalies. If you have steady hands and an excellent bedside manner, we want to meet you.
*Responsibilities:*
* Ensure patients are at ease before examinations
* Properly sterilize dental instruments
* Conduct initial mouth screenings and review oral health history
* Identify conditions like gingivitis, caries, or periodontitis
* Clean and protect patients' teeth (e.g., remove plaque or apply fluoride)
* Educate patients on proper teeth care, demonstrating good brushing techniques
* Provide post-operation instructions to patients
* Take X-rays or dental impressions
* Assist dentists in selecting appropriate treatments for various diseases, including oral cancer
* Maintain documentation and charts for each patient
* Monitor supplies

The Associate Dentist will perform routine and complex dental procedures on patients according to their oral health needs and cosmetic concerns. The Associate Dentist’s responsibilities include developing suitable treatment plans for patients, keeping an accurate record of all appointments, diagnoses, and treatments, and answering patients’ questions.
Associate Dentist Responsibilities:
* Examining patients' teeth and gums to diagnose and treat various oral health issues.
* Utilizing X-rays and computer-generated imaging to assist with examinations.
* Providing dental treatments to patients, including routine cleanings, extractions, dental fillings, teeth whitening, bonding, and applications of dental crowns, implants, and veneers.
* Educating patients on good oral hygiene practices and advising them on proper aftercare following certain dental procedures.
Associate Dentist Requirements:
* Doctor of dental surgery (DDS) or doctor of medicine in dentistry (DMD).
* State license to practice dentistry.
* CPR certification.
* The ability to use various dental instruments and equipment.
